Output b66e89dd9fb41096f817c3a39ab30628412cead40a7eba0f8e43a64c20b80d91:1

value
8596128
script pubkey
OP_0 OP_PUSHBYTES_20 c3b26de73952be781011b5e8e8ea76366319daf5
address
ltc1qcwexmeee22l8syq3kh5w36nkxe33nkh4892da3
transaction
b66e89dd9fb41096f817c3a39ab30628412cead40a7eba0f8e43a64c20b80d91
spent
true